I try to get information from original sources when possible, leaks, info from FOIA requests, even those we are not supposed to see, anti-Chinese criticisms that come from pro-Chinese sources, and pro-Chinese admissions that come from generally anti-Chinese sources. The best "gems" come from researching items that come from sources which apparently slip up and accidentally admit the opposite of their usual agenda. (Such as the Bolton interview I heard.)
    Here's an innocuous example: Let's say that a person who generally writes anti-Chinese propaganda says something like, "well it's true that China has a 5 percent GDP growth rate this year, but this already represents a slowdown and presents a better picture than it can probably maintain, because [trade tarriffs, high debt, etc. etc.] . . . " 
    In the above, we can be pretty sure that the 5 percent growth rate has a high chance of being correct, or even understated, because it was admitted to be true, even when the person probably didn't want to admit it. Further research would show that the actual rate had been 6 percent, and that it really was a "slowdown" -- but a slowdown that is still twice as fast as the US growth rate. International financial newspapers and magazines which I used to get at work all the time were always full of "surprises" like this to help you build up a picture from such items. A reader has to be skeptical at all times, of everone on every side of an issue, and do this a lot, to get a better overall picture.

    CARROLLTON, Ala. (WIAT) — Three people who were killed during a tornado last Saturday will be laid to rest in the coming weeks.
    Tyrone Spain, 51, will have a funeral at 1 p.m. Saturday at the Aliceville City Hall.
    On Jan. 25, there will be a memorial service Albert and Susan Barnett at Jehovah’s Witnesses Kingdom Hall in Duncanville that will start at 1 p.m. Albert was 85 years old while Susan was 75.
    The Barnetts and Spain all lived on Settlement Road outside Carrollton and were in their separate homes when the tornado hit. The three were the only people in the state killed during the weekend storms.

    Bengaluru doctors save life of 4-year-old boy with bloodless bone marrow transplant
    The boy belongs to the Jehovah’s Witnesses faith, the followers of which cannot take blood transfusions as treatment.

    It is not rare for doctors to take young children for bone marrow transplants. In fact, it is one of the most effective treatments for certain forms of leukaemia and other disorders. However, when the individual in question belongs to a faith which doesn’t permit them to get a normal blood transfusion, how do doctors tackle such a challenge? Bloodless bone marrow transplants are given to individuals belonging to the Jehovah’s Witnesses faith, and this was exactly the method used by doctors in Bengaluru to save a 4-year-old boy.
    Ittai James Moshi and his parents hail from Tanzania. The boy’s parents are both IT professionals who moved to Bengaluru in 2018 for his treatment. He was diagnosed with a form of abdominal cancer and required a bone marrow transplant to treat him. However, the standard procedure to initiate a bone marrow transplant involves getting a blood transfusion. As Ittai and his parents belong to the Jehovah’s Witnesses community, it was not allowed for him to undergo the routine transplant.
